Understanding Your KitchenAid Food Processor
Before we troubleshoot, let's quickly understand the main components of your KitchenAid food processor. It typically includes the base, the work bowl, the lid, the feed tube, the pusher, and the various blades and discs. Familiarizing yourself with these parts will help you identify and address any issues more effectively.
Common Issues and Solutions
- Food Processor Won't Turn On
Check if the unit is properly plugged in and the outlet is working. Try using another appliance to confirm the outlet's functionality.

Inspect the cord for any damage or fraying. If you find any, it's best to replace the cord for safety reasons.
Ensure the on/off switch is in the 'on' position. Some models have a lock feature that prevents accidental operation; make sure it's not engaged.
Overheating is a common cause for this issue. Allow the unit to cool down for at least 30 minutes before trying again.

Check if the food processor is overloaded. Reduce the amount of food and try again.
Inspect the blades and discs for any signs of damage or wear. Replace them if necessary.

Preventative Maintenance for Your KitchenAid Food Processor
Regular cleaning and maintenance can help prevent many issues from arising. Always unplug the unit before cleaning, and follow these steps:
- Wash the work bowl, lid, blades, and discs in warm, soapy water or place them on the top rack of your dishwasher.
- Wipe the base with a damp cloth, ensuring no food residue remains.
- Inspect the blades and discs for any signs of wear and replace them if necessary.
- Store the food processor with the blades and discs removed to prevent damage and maintain their sharpness.
When to Seek Professional Help
While many issues can be resolved at home, there are times when it's best to seek professional help. If your food processor is still not working after trying the troubleshooting steps above, or if you suspect a motor issue, contact KitchenAid's customer service or a certified appliance repair technician.
